Baby Bear’s Not Hibernating

Baby Black Bear has had so much fun with his friends moose, owl, and rabbit, that he’s decided not to join his parents in hibernation for the winter. So as the weather begins to turn cold and snow starts to fall, Baby Bear just keeps frolicking, all under the watchful but unseen eye of his dad. After a while, Baby Bear begins to realize that life outside the den is not quite as nice in the winter as he thought, and frozen twigs don’t make much of a meal. With the help of his friends he makes it back to shelter to spend a cozy winter with his mom and dad.

Lynn Plourde’s tales is brought vividly to life through the illustrations of Teri Weidner. Exploring themes of friendship, diversity, working as a team, and parenting, it also includes fascinating facts about America’s most common bear.
